    Born in Fort Devens, Massachusetts Quigley comes from a family in which he isn’t the only one with golf in his veins; his uncle is the PGA Tour and Champions Tour professional, Dana Quigley. Quigley actually caddied for his uncle at the Greater Hartford Open, on the 1982 Champions Tour. His father Paul also had a love of golf, and was a top amateur golfer in New England. Quigley discovered his love of golf at an early age, and went on to study at the University of South Carolina, where he was twice Academic All-American.

    Quigley won the 1987 US Junior Amateur, before going on to turn professional in 1991. Since turning professional Quigley has spent time playing on both the PGA Tour and the Nationwide Tour. He has had a varied amount of success, having achieved two wins on the Nationwide Tour, the 1996 NIKE Philadelphia Classic, and the 2001 BUY.COMArkansas Classic, and finishing at best in second place on the PGA Tour. Although he does not have a large build, Quigley is a good driver, but his main strength lies in the short game.

    Away from the golf course Quigley has made his home in Jupiter, Florida. As of the end of 2014 Quigley has yet to achieve a win on the PGA Tour, having amassed total prize money of $11,058,694.
